Main duties of the job Main Duties of the Job As a Specialist Doctor in Rehabilitation Medicine, you will play a key role in delivering specialist rehabilitation care across the Major Trauma Centre (MTC), Hyperacute Rehabilitation Team (HART) and Neurorehabilitation Services at Southmead Hospital. You will assess and manage patients with major trauma, neurological conditions and complex rehabilitation needs, supporting recovery from the earliest stages through to discharge and rehabilitation. You will lead rehabilitation assessments, provide specialist advice to acute wards and critical care areas, coordinate rehabilitation plans and support discharge planning. Working closely with consultants, therapists, psychologists, nurses and regional rehabilitation providers, you will help ensure patients receive high-quality multidisciplinary care. The role includes participation in multidisciplinary team meetings, trauma board rounds, family meetings and case conferences, helping to optimise patient outcomes and ensure timely access to rehabilitation services. You will also support outpatient clinics in neurorehabilitation and spasticity management, including botulinum toxin treatments and intrathecal baclofen therapy. In addition, you will contribute to teaching, clinical governance, audit, research, quality improvement and service development activities, supporting the development of rehabilitation services across the Trust and the wider Severn Major Trauma Network.
